EasyJet announced an agreement in principle to accept a £5.5bn takeover offer from the US investment firm Castlelake.

The proposed takeover price is £6.90 per share.

The deal would take the company private.

EasyJet rejected a previous offer of £6.50 per share ten days prior to the new agreement.

EasyJet stated the previous offer of £6.50 per share substantially undervalued the business.

EasyJet's shares closed at £5.58 on Friday.

The closing share price of £5.58 gave EasyJet a market value of £4.2bn.

Stelios Haji-Ioannou and his family own more than 15% of EasyJet.

If the deal completes, it could be worth nearly £800m for Stelios Haji-Ioannou.

Castlelake said it is supportive of EasyJet’s plans to buy newer planes to modernise its fleet and cut fuel costs.

Castlelake indicated it will set up a European holding company controlled by EU nationals to comply with EU restrictions on airlines.

Castlelake has until 5pm on 3 August to make a firm offer or walk away.
